Obituary of Alexa Cucopulos

Our beloved Alexa Natalya Cucopulos, 25, of Franklin Lakes, peaceably passed away in her sleep on Saturday, April 25, 2020 at her residence in Durham, North Carolina where she was a graduate student at Duke University. Alexa earned her bachelor’s degree in philosophy at Emory University, where she was an honors student, a Phi Beta Kappa recipient in her junior year, and the winner of the Paul Kuntz Prize for the best-performing senior in philosophy. At the time of her passing she was in her third year in the Duke University Literature PhD program and was also pursuing a certificate in gender, sexuality, and feminist studies. Alexa was a promising scholar and activist who was drawn to philosophy, poetry, language, and justice. But more than her scholarly achievements, Alexa possessed an incredible sense of beauty and was an accomplished artist, writer and equestrian as well as a fantastic chef. In addition, she was loving, kind and so very witty. She will be deeply and sorely missed by all of her family, friends and colleagues. Alexa is adored and survived by her parents Gregory and Deborah Cucopulos and her brother Nicholas. She loved to spend time with her immediate and extended family and is also survived by her many, many aunts and uncles and cousins who now deeply mourn her loss. She will be in eternal rest with her grandparents Catherine and Natale Formica and Mary and Nicholas Cucopulos. Donations can be made in her memory to The National Stem Cell Foundation: https://nationalstemcellfoundation.org/research/ as well as the Arthritis National Research Foundation: https://curearthritis.org Due to the current social restrictions, a private service will be held for the immediate family only. A memorial service and celebration of Alexa’s life will be held at a future date.
